Neo4j端口配置如何設(shè)置

小樊
88
2024-10-29 12:09:56

Neo4j是一個(gè)高性能的圖數(shù)據(jù)庫(kù),它允許通過(guò)HTTP和Bolt協(xié)議進(jìn)行數(shù)據(jù)訪問(wèn)。默認(rèn)情況下,Neo4j使用端口7474用于HTTP訪問(wèn),端口7687用于Bolt協(xié)議訪問(wèn)。以下是如何配置Neo4j端口的步驟:

Neo4j端口配置步驟

  1. 打開(kāi)配置文件

    • 在Unix/Linux系統(tǒng)中,配置文件通常位于/etc/neo4j/neo4j.conf
    • 在Windows系統(tǒng)中,配置文件位于Neo4j安裝目錄下的conf\neo4j.conf。
  2. 修改端口設(shè)置

    • 找到以下配置項(xiàng)并修改它們:
      • dbms.connector.bolt.listen_address:設(shè)置為0.0.0.0以允許遠(yuǎn)程連接。
      • dbms.connector.http.listen_address:設(shè)置為0.0.0.0以允許遠(yuǎn)程連接。

注意事項(xiàng)

  • 在修改端口配置后,需要重啟Neo4j服務(wù)以使更改生效。
  • 確保所選端口沒(méi)有被其他服務(wù)占用。
  • 在生產(chǎn)環(huán)境中,建議使用安全措施來(lái)保護(hù)這些端口,例如防火墻和訪問(wèn)控制列表等。

通過(guò)以上步驟,您可以成功配置Neo4j的端口,以便更好地滿(mǎn)足您的網(wǎng)絡(luò)和安全需求。

0